Clause 60

Specific acts that do not constitute publication

(1)

The following provisions provide that certain acts in certain circumstances are not to be treated as publication:

(a)

section 223(4) (publicising public exhibition);

(b)

section 225(3) (making public collection available on network of public collection);

(c)

section 226(3) (copying or communicating material for users of public collection);

(d)

section 227(3) (copying originals for use on premises of public collection);

(e)

section 228(3) (copying or communicating unpublished thesis in university library or archive);

(f)

section 229(3) (copying or communicating unpublished old material in public collection);

(g)

section 233(3) (copying or communicating material for administrative purposes of public collection);

(h)

section 244(4) (copying for computational data analysis);

(i)

section 278(3) (copying or communicating material in public registers);

(j)

section 281(3) (copying or communicating publicly disclosed material);

(k)

section 283(3) (data sharing within public sector);

(l)

section 287 (public act).

(2)

To avoid doubt, the provisions mentioned in subsection (1) do not limit section 53(2).
